General Release and Waiver of Claims. In consideration of the severance payments and other benefits to which I have become entitled, pursuant to that certain Amended and Restated Employment Agreement between Nanogen,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the “Company”), and myself dated , 2007 (the “Employment Agreement), in connection with the termination of my employment on this date, I, , hereby furnish the Company with the following release and waiver (“Release and Waiver”). I hereby release and forever discharge the Company, its officers, directors, agents, employees, stockholders, successors, assigns and affiliates from any and all claims, liabilities, demands, causes of action, costs, expenses, attorney fees, damages, indemnities and obligations of every kind and nature, in law, equity or otherwise, known and unknown, suspected and unsuspected, disclosed and undisclosed, arising from or relating to my employment with the Company and the termination of that employment, including (without limitation) claims of wrongful discharge, emotional distress, defamation, fraud, breach of contract, breach of the covenant of good faith and fair dealing, discrimination claims based on sex, age, race, national origin, disability or any other basis under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, as amended, the California Fair Employment and Housing Act, the Federal Age Discrimination in Employment Act of 1967, as amended (“ADEA”), the Americans with Disability Act, contract claims, tort claims, and wage or benefit claims, including but not limited to, claims for salary, bonuses, commissions, stock grants, stock options, vacation pay, fringe benefits, severance pay or any other form of compensation (other than the payments, rights, benefits and indemnification to which I am, pursuant to the express provisions of the Employment Agreement, entitled in connection with my termination of employment, my vested rights under the Company’s Section 401(k) Plan and any worker’s compensation benefits under any Company workers’ compensation insurance policy or fund). General Release and Waiver of Claims a. Employee hereby waives and fully releases and forever discharges the University from any and all claims, causes of action, complaints, damages, agreements, suits, attorney’s fees, loss, cost or expense, obligations and liabilities, of whatever kind or character, any statutory claims, or any and all other matters of whatever kind, nature or description, whether known or unknown, occurring prior to the date of the execution of this Agreement, which Employee may have against the University, by reason of or arising out of or concerning Employee’s employment with the University. Employee acknowledges and agrees that Employee’s release of claims specifically includes, but is not limited to, any retreat rights, as well as any and all claims under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, 42 U.S.C. section 2000 et seq.; the Age Discrimination in Employment Act, 29 U.S.C. section 621 et seq. (“ADEA”); the Federal Civil Rights Statutes, 42 U.S.C. sections 1981, 1982, 1983, 1985 and 1986; the Americans with Disabilities Act; the Equal Pay Act; the California Fair Employment and Housing Act, California Government Code section 12940 et seq.; the Family and Medical Leave Act; the California Labor Code; and the Xxxxx Civil Rights Act based upon events occurring prior to the date of the execution of this Agreement. In so doing, Employee expressly acknowledges and agrees that Employee hereby waives all rights Employee may have under Section 1542 of the California Civil Code, which provides: A general release does not extend to claims that the creditor or releasing party does not know or suspect to exist in his or her favor at the time of executing the release and that, if known by him or her, would have materially affected his or her settlement with the debtor or released party. Employee understands and acknowledges that the consideration provided for in this Agreement is in full and complete settlement of all claims of any kind, whether known or unknown, actual or potential, which Employee may have against the University in connection with Employee’s employment, working conditions, and any other conduct of the Parties occurring prior to the date of the execution of this Agreement.
General Release and Waiver of Claims. In exchange and in consideration for the promises, obligations, and agreements undertaken by Grainger herein, which the Officer agrees and acknowledges are adequate and sufficient consideration, the Officer, on behalf of himself, his spouse, agents, representatives, attorneys, assigns, heirs, executors, administrators, and other personal representatives, releases and forever discharges Grainger, the Affiliates, and all of their officers, employees, directors, agents, attorneys, personal representatives, predecessors, successors, and assigns (hereinafter collectively referred to as the “Releasees”) from any and all claims of any kind which he has, or might have, as of the date of this Agreement; or which are based on any facts which exist or existed on or before the date of this Agreement. The claims the Officer is releasing include, but are not limited to, all claims relating in any way to his employment at Grainger or his separation from that employment; and all claims under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, the Civil Rights Act of 1991, 42 U.S.C. § 1981, the Equal Pay Act, the Employee Retirement Income Security Act, the Americans with Disabilities Act, the Federal Rehabilitation Act, the Age Discrimination in Employment Act (“ADEA”), the Older Worker Benefit Protection Act, the Illinois Human Rights Act, the Illinois Wage Payment and Collection Act, or any other federal, state or local law relating to employment, discrimination, retaliation, or wages, or under the common law of any state (including, without limitation, claims relating to contracts, wrongful discharge, retaliatory discharge, defamation, intentional or negligent infliction of emotional distress, and wrongful termination of benefits). The Officer also releases and forever discharges Grainger and all other Releasees from any and all other demands, claims, causes of action, obligations, agreements, promises, representations, damages, suits, and liabilities whatsoever, both known and unknown, in law or in equity, which he has or might have as of the date of this Agreement. The Officer understands that this Section 5 of this Agreement contains a complete and general release of any claim that he now has against Grainger and all other Releasees, or could ever have against Grainger and all other Releasees, based on any fact, event, or omission that has occurred up to the time at which he signs the Agreement. General Release and Waiver of Claims. In exchange for and in consideration of the Severance Benefits, Executive, on behalf of himself/herself and his/her successors, assigns, heirs, executors, and administrators, hereby releases and forever discharges the Company and its parents, affiliates, associated entities, representatives, successors and assigns, and their officers, directors, shareholders, agents and employees from all liability, claims and demands, actions and causes of action, damages, costs, payments and expenses of every kind, nature or description arising out of his/her employment relationship with the Company, or the ending of his/her employment on , 20 . These claims, demands, actions or causes of action include, but are not limited to, actions sounding in contract, tort, discrimination of any kind, and causes of action or claims arising under federal, state, or local laws, including, but not limited to, claims under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, as amended by the Civil Rights Act of 1991, the Age Discrimination in Employment Act of 1967, as amended by the Older Workers Benefit Protection Act of 1990, the Americans With Disabilities Act, and any similar state or local laws. Executive further agrees that Executive will neither seek nor accept any further benefit or consideration from any source whatsoever in respect to any claims which Executive has asserted or could have asserted against the Company. Executive represents to his/her knowledge neither Executive nor any person or entity acting on Executive’s behalf or with Executive’s authority has asserted with any federal, state, or local judicial or administrative body any claim of any kind based on or arising out of any aspect of Executive’s employment with the Company or the ending of that employment. If Executive, or any person or entity representing Executive, or any federal, state, or local agency, asserts any such claim, this Release and Waiver Agreement will act as a total and complete bar to recovery of any judgment, award, damages, or remedy of any kind.
General Release and Waiver of Claims a. For and in consideration of the special severance pay and other benefits provided to you under this Agreement, which are conditioned on your signing of this Agreement and to which you would not otherwise be entitled, and other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which is hereby acknowledged, on your own behalf and that of your heirs, executors, administrators, beneficiaries, representatives and assigns, and all others connected with or claiming through you, hereby release and forever discharge the Company and its subsidiaries and other affiliates and all of their respective past, present and future officers, directors, trustees, shareholders, employees, agents, employee benefit plans, general and limited partners, members, managers, investors, joint venturers, representatives, successors and assigns, and all others connected with any of them, both individually and in their official capacities, from any and all causes of action, rights and claims of any type or description, known or unknown, which you have had in the past, now have, or might now have, through the date of your signing of this Agreement, in any way related to, connected with or arising out of your employment or its termination (including without limitation any claims under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, the Age Discrimination in Employment Act, as amended by the Older Workers Benefit Protection Act, the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 (“ERISA”), the Americans with Disabilities Act, and/or the wage and hour, wage payment and fair employment practices statute of the state or states in which you were previously employed by the Company or otherwise had a relationship with the Company or any of its subsidiaries or other affiliates, each as amended from time to time). This Agreement shall not apply to (a) any claim that arises after you sign this Agreement, (b) any claim that may not be waived pursuant to applicable law, (c) claims for indemnification in your capacity as an officer or director of the Company under the Company’s Certificate of Incorporation, By-laws or agreement, if any, providing for director or officer indemnification, (d) rights to receive insurance coverage and payments under any insurance policy maintained by the Company and (e) rights to equity compensation or to receive retirement benefits that are accrued and fully vested as of the Separation Date and rights under any plans protected by ERISA.
